一种快速浏览文档的方法及装置的制造方法

文档序号:8223644阅读:146来源:国知局
一种快速浏览文档的方法及装置的制造方法
【技术领域】
[0001]本发明涉及计算机科学技术领域,尤其涉及一种快速浏览文档的方法及装置。
【背景技术】
[0002]在现有的计算机技术中,存在快速浏览文档的方法,通常的实现方式是:在显示屏幕上同时显示文档的原图和缩略图;当用户点击缩略图时,可以同步跳转并显示对应页码的原图,从而实现快速浏览。例如PPT及PDF软件均具备此类功能。
[0003]随着智能移动终端设备的发展,在智能移动终端上进行文档阅读也非常普遍,由于智能移动终端显示屏幕较小,如果在智能移动终端的显示屏幕上显示缩略图将难以清晰辨认,因此,上述快速浏览文档的方法无法直接应用于智能移动终端,目前在智能移动终端等显示屏幕较小的终端上只能按照顺序逐页查找文档,无法实现快速浏览。

【发明内容】

[0004]本发明提供了一种快速浏览文档的方法,能够在显示屏幕较小的终端上实现文档快速浏览。
[0005]本发明还提供了一种快速浏览文档的装置,能够在显示屏幕较小的终端上实现文档快速浏览。
[0006]本发明的技术方案是这样实现的:
[0007]一种快速浏览文档的方法,包括:
[0008]针对文档的每一页,生成原图及缩略图,并按照预先设置的缓存路径保存所述原图及缩略图;
[0009]在第一显示区域显示所述缩略图,在第二显示区域显示所述文档;
[0010]获取显示原图指令,在第二显示区域显示所述原图,并停止显示所述文档;
[0011]获取跳转页码指令,将文档跳转至所述页码,在第二显示区域显示所述文档。
[0012]一种快速浏览文档的装置,包括:
[0013]图片生成模块,用于针对文档的每一页,生成原图及缩略图,并按照预先设置的缓存路径保存所述原图及缩略图;
[0014]第一显示模块,用于在第一显示区域显示所述缩略图,还用于获取显示原图指令及跳转页码指令;
[0015]第二显示模块,用于在第二显示区域显示所述文档;还用于根据所述显示原图指令在第二显示区域显示所述原图,同时停止显示所述文档;还用于根据所述跳转页码指令将文档跳转至所述页码,并在第二显示区域显示所述文档。
[0016]可见,本发明提出的快速浏览文档的方法和装置,采用两个显示区域分别显示文档及文档页码的缩略图,用户可以发送显示某页原图的指令,根据该指令,在原本显示文档的区域显示该原图;这样,用户可以清晰分辨该页内容,从而准确找到需要跳转的页,实现文档的快速浏览。
【附图说明】
[0017]图1为本发明提出的快速浏览文档的方法实现流程图;
[0018]图2为本发明提出的快速浏览文档的装置结构示意图;
[0019]图3为本发明实施例一的实现流程图。
【具体实施方式】
[0020]本发明提出一种快速浏览文档的方法,如图1为该方法实现流程图,包括:
[0021]步骤101:针对文档的每一页,生成原图及缩略图,并按照预先设置的缓存路径保存所述原图及缩略图;
[0022]步骤102:在第一显示区域显示所述缩略图,在第二显示区域显示所述文档;
[0023]步骤103:获取显示原图指令,在第二显示区域显示所述原图,并停止显示所述文档;
[0024]步骤104:获取跳转页码指令,将文档跳转至所述页码,在第二显示区域显示所述文档。
[0025]上述步骤103之后,并在步骤104之前,可以进一步包括步骤103’:获取停止显示原图指令,停止显示所述原图,并在第二显示区域恢复显示所述文档。
[0026]上述步骤101之前,可以进一步包括:设置原图和缩略图的大小;
[0027]相应地,上述步骤101中生成原图及缩略图的方式可以为:按照原图和缩略图的大小生成原图及缩略图。
[0028]上述步骤102中,在第一显示区域显示缩略图时,还可以进一步显示缩略图所对应的文档页码。
[0029]上述过程中,步骤103中的显示原图指令可以为:所述第一显示区域中的缩略图的鼠标长按事件;
[0030]步骤103’中的停止显示原图指令可以为:所述第一显示区域中的缩略图的鼠标离开事件;
[0031]步骤104中的获取跳转页码指令可以为:所述第一显示区域中的缩略图的鼠标点击事件。
[0032]这样,当用户需要跳转页码时,可以首先在第一显示区域找到疑似的缩略图(由于缩略图较小,无法清晰辨认,故为疑似);之后,用户长按该缩略图,本发明采用的装置感应到该鼠标长按事件时,在第二显示区域显示该缩略图对应的原图,以便用户能够清晰分辨该页内容;之后,用户放开该缩略图,本发明采用的装置感应到该鼠标离开事件时,在第二显示区域停止显示该原图,并恢复显示文档。通过这种方式,用户可以方便地查看文档各页内容。当用户选定需要跳转的页码之后,点击第一显示区域中对应页码的缩略图,本发明采用的装置感应到该鼠标点击事件时,将文档跳转至该页码,并显示该文档。
[0033]为实现原图显示及文档跳转,可以采用如下方式:
[0034]所述按照预先设置的缓存路径保存原图及缩略图之后进一步包括:保存采集数据,所述采集数据包括缩略图缓存路径与原图缓存路径的对应关系,其中,缩略图缓存路径中包含缩略图对应文档页码的信息,原图缓存路径中包含原图对应文档页码的信息;
[0035]获取第一显示区域中的缩略图的鼠标长按事件后,在第二显示区域显示原图的方式可以为:获取与所述鼠标长按事件绑定的采集数据及所述缩略图的缓存路径,通过所述采集数据获取所述缩略图缓存路径对应的原图缓存路径,根据该原图缓存路径加载所述原图,并在第二显示区域显示所述原图;
[0036]获取第一显示区域中的缩略图的鼠标点击事件后,将文档跳转至所述页码的方式可以为:获取与所述鼠标点击事件绑定的采集数据,通过所述采集数据获取所述缩略图对应文档页码的信息,将文档跳转至所述页码。
[0037]相应地,本发明还提出一种快速浏览文档的装置,如图2为该装置的结构示意图,包括:
[0038]图片生成模块210,用于针对文档的每一页,生成原图及缩略图,并按照预先设置的缓存路径保存所述原图及缩略图;
[0039]第一显示模块220,用于在第一显示区域显示所述缩略图,还用于获取显示原图指令及跳转页码指令;
[0040]第二显示模块230,用于在第二显示区域显示所述文档;还用于根据所述显示原图指令在第二显示区域显示所述原图,同时停止显示所述文档;还用于根据所述跳转页码指令将文档跳转至所述页码,并在第二显示区域显示所述文档。
[0041]上述装置中,第一显示模块220还可以用于,获取停止显示原图指令;
[0042]相应地,第二显示模块230还可以用于,根据所述停止显示原图指令在第二显示区域停止显示所述原图,并恢复显示所述文档。
[0043]上述装置还可以包括:采集数据保存模块240,用于保存采集数据,所述采集数据包括缩略图缓存路径与原图缓存路径的对应关系,其中,缩略图缓存路径中包含缩略图对应文档页码的信息,原图缓存路径中包含原图对应文档页码的信息;
[0044]上述第一显示模块220可以包括:
[0045]缩略图显示子模块221,用于在第一显示区域显示缩略图;
[0046]事件感应及处理子模块222,用于感应到第一显示区域中的缩略图的鼠标长按事件时,查找所述鼠标长按事件绑定的采集数据及所述缩略图的缓存路径,通过所述采集数据获取所述缩略图缓存路径对应的原图缓存路径,将所述原图缓存路径发送至第二显示模块230 ;还用于感应到第一显示区域中的缩略图的鼠标离开事件时,向第二显示模块230发送停止显示原图指令;
[0047]上述第二显示模块230可以包括:
[0048]文档显示子模块231,用于在第二显示区域显示文档;
[0049]原图显示子模块232,用于根据所述原图缓存路径加载对应的原图,在第二显示区域显示所述原图,并停止显示所述文档;还用于根据所述停止显示原图指令在第二显示区域停止显示原图,并恢复显示所述文档。
[0050]上述事件感应及处理子模块222还可以用于,感应到第一显示区域中的缩略图的鼠标点击事件时,获取与所述鼠标点击事件绑定的采集数据,通过所述采集数据获取所述缩略图对应文档页码的信息,将所述页码信息发送至第二显示模块230 ;
[0051]文档显示子模块231还可以用于,根据所述页码信息将文档跳转至所述页码,并在第二显示区域显示文档。
[0052]以下结合附图,举具体的实施例详细介绍。
[0053]实施例一:
[0
当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1